Irresistible Spicy Pork Ribs

These Spicy Pork Ribs are slow-cooked in the oven until tender, then finished on the grill for a deliciously sticky glaze.

Ingredients
  

Group: Ingredients
  • 3 lbs. baby back pork ribs
  • 2 Tbsp. smoked paprika
  • 1 Tbsp. ground cumin
  • 1 Tbsp. chili powder
  • 1 Tbsp. garlic powder
  • 1 Tbsp. onion powder
  • 1 tsp. cayenne pepper adjust for heat preference
  • 2 tsp. kosher salt
  • 1/2 tsp. black pepper
  • 1 cup barbecue sauce
  • 1 Tbsp. apple cider vinegar
  • honey or brown sugar for glazing, optional

Method
 

  1. Preheat your oven to 300°F (150°C).
  2. Remove the silver skin from the back of the ribs to allow the spices to penetrate better.
  3. Combine the smoked paprika, cumin, chili powder, garlic powder, onion powder, cayenne pepper, salt, and black pepper.
  4. Rub the spice mixture onto both sides of the ribs and let marinate for at least an hour, ideally overnight.
  5. Wrap the ribs in foil and bake for 2.5 to 3 hours until tender.
  6. Unwrap the foil, brush BBQ sauce over the ribs, and grill or broil for 5-10 minutes until caramelized.
  7. Let the ribs rest for a few minutes before cutting and serve with extra BBQ sauce on the side.

Notes

Marinate overnight for stronger flavor and be careful not to overcook on the grill/broiler.
